Burlington, N.C. --- The sixth-seeded University of Mount Olive softball team saw its season come to an end in a 9-3 loss to eighth-seeded Lees-McRae College in the 2017 Conference Carolinas Softball Tournament in Burlington, N.C.
GAME INFORMATION
Score: Lees-McRae 9, Mount Olive 3
Records: Mount Olive (25-29), Lees-McRae (15-33)
Location: Springwood Park, Burlington, N.C.

GAME RUNDOWN
- Lees-McRae scored first in the top of the third inning to give the Bobcats a 1-0 lead.
- The Bobcats tacked on three more runs in the top of the fourth to push Lees-McRae ahead, 4-0.
- In the top of the sixth, Lees-McRae's lead ballooned to six at 6-0 with two more runs being pushed across.
- UMO got on the board in the bottom half of the sixth, scoring three runs on three RBI doubles to cut Lees-McRae's lead in half at 6-3.
- The Bobcats pushed their lead back to six with three more runs in the top of the seventh as Lees-McRae grabbed the 9-3 win.
KEY STATS
- Juniors Kayla Allen and Kristin Power each led the Trojans with two hits.
- In the circle, freshman Karen Foley (L: 3-10) was credited with the loss, pitching 3.1 innings, allowing three earned runs on six hits and striking out a pair.
NOTES
The Trojans' season comes to an end with the loss. UMO amassed a 25-29 record and a 13-9 mark in Conference Carolinas play during the regular season.
